What this means for growing in Lincoln University
Each reading below is measured for Lincoln University itself — here is what it means for a garden here, and the move an experienced grower makes about it.

Season length
MeasuredLincoln University runs about 215 days between hard freezes — a long growing season.
There is slack for succession plantings and slow-finishing crops: many vegetables can be sown twice, and the heat-lovers have time to ripen fully.
Plan a second sowing of quick crops after the first comes out, and use the fall window most gardeners let sit idle.
NOAA 1991–2020 Climate Normals

Winter hardiness
MeasuredLincoln University sits in USDA hardiness zone 7a.
The zone sets which perennials, shrubs, and fruit trees live through an average winter here — a plant rated for a colder zone is a safe bet, one rated warmer needs winter protection or gets treated as an annual.
Match perennials and fruit to the zone before you buy, so nothing you plant is a gamble against the cold.

When does frost risk typically end in Lincoln University?
The last hard freeze (28°F) in Lincoln University typically lands around Apr 3, per NOAA 1991–2020 climate normals — earlier than the light-frost dates most charts quote. That marks the hard freeze, not the last light frost — lighter frosts keep biting past it, which is why tender transplants here wait until about Apr 24.
When is the first frost in Lincoln University?
The first hard freeze (28°F) in Lincoln University typically arrives around Nov 4, per NOAA 1991–2020 climate normals — the point tender summer crops finish. Lighter frosts run ahead of it, near Oct 21, so the watching starts about Oct 5 — about 215 days after the spring freeze cleared.
How long is the growing season in Lincoln University?
Measured between 28°F hard freezes, Lincoln University sees about 215 frost-free days — roughly Apr 3 through Nov 4, per NOAA 1991–2020 climate normals. Tender crops work a shorter one: nearer Apr 24 to Oct 21, about 180 days.

How do I protect my plants from frost in Lincoln University?
From about Oct 5 the job here turns from planting to protecting — the last start even a 30-day crop can finish. As the season closes around the first 28°F hard freeze near Nov 4 (NOAA 1991–2020 climate normals), three moves buy time: row cover or an old sheet over tender plants on still, clear nights; water the soil the afternoon before a freeze, so it holds warmth overnight; and harvest tomatoes, peppers and basil before Nov 4. Hardy greens and roots shrug off light frost and sweeten after it — leave them in.
